Terms of Service
1. What maniquest is
maniquest is a web application where users set one task ("quest") each day — planned the night before, or the same day if none was set — and prove they followed through with a live photo. By default, your quests and photos are kept long-term so you can look back on them; you can turn this off in Settings, in which case they're deleted daily instead. Whether your quests and photos are visible to other users depends on your profile's public/private setting — see the Privacy Policy below for details.

Privacy Policy
1. What data we collect
- Email address — used for account login and identification.
- Password — stored securely (hashed, never in plain text).
- Profile info (optional) — a tagline and profile picture, if you choose to add them.
- Quest text — the task you set each day.
- Proof photos — live photos you take to prove you completed your quest.
- Extra photos (optional) — additional photos you choose to add to a quest after it's been proven, from your camera or your gallery.
- Feedback you send us — any message you submit through the in-app feedback form, and a screenshot too, if you choose to attach one.
- Reports you submit — if you report another user's quest or photo, we store the reason and any details you provide.
- Push notification subscription (optional) — if you enable reminders in Settings, your browser generates a unique subscription address and a pair of encryption keys, which we store in order to send you notifications. This is only collected if you turn reminders on, and is tied to your device/browser, not to you personally.

3. How long we keep your data
- By default, quest text and proof photos are kept for as long as your account is active, so you can look back on your own history. If you turn this off in Settings, they're instead deleted automatically every night from that point onward — this never retroactively deletes anything already saved. Neither setting involves separate backups or archives.
- If a quest or photo is placed under an investigation hold — because it may involve seriously illegal content — it is preserved rather than deleted, and kept out of public view, until the hold is lifted or the matter is resolved with the relevant authorities. This is retained on the basis of our legitimate interest, and potentially legal obligation, in addressing suspected criminal activity.
- Your account details (email, password, streak, lifetime total, profile info) are kept for as long as your account is active.
- If you choose to save a photo to your own device before it's deleted, that copy is yours and is no longer something maniquest can access or control.
- Feedback you send, and reports you submit about other users, are kept indefinitely as a record of past issues — these aren't cleared by the nightly reset.
- If an account is suspended, a record of the suspension (when, for how long, and why) is kept even after the suspension ends, and even if the account is later deleted. This is standard practice for moderation and safety records, and is retained on the basis of our legitimate interest in keeping maniquest safe.
- If you've enabled push notifications, your subscription is kept until you turn reminders off, or until your browser or device reports the subscription no longer exists (for example, if you've uninstalled the app), at which point it's automatically removed.

7. Cookies
maniquest uses a small number of strictly necessary cookies to operate:
- A session cookie, which keeps you signed in while you use the app.
- An optional "remember me" cookie, set only if you tick "Remember me" when signing in, which keeps you signed in for up to 30 days without needing to log in again.
These cookies are essential to how maniquest works and are not used for tracking, advertising, or analytics. Because of this, they don't require separate cookie consent under applicable law.
